Data Snapshot: ZIP 77505 (Pasadena, TX)

Homeowners in ZIP 77505 (Pasadena, TX) pay an average of $3,289 per year for insurance as of 2022, according to U.S. Treasury FIO ZIP-level data across approximately 980 reported policies. The U.S. average sits at $1,776 per year, so this ZIP runs 85% above that mark and lands in the 96th national percentile. The Texas statewide average is $2,349 per year; this ZIP sits 40% above that figure, ranking #94 of 1504 tracked ZIPs in Texas by premium. The closest-priced peer within Texas is Hunt (ZIP 78024) at $3,285, essentially matching this ZIP's rate.

The loss ratio for ZIP 77505 is 18.7%, meaning insurers retained a working margin after claims. Claim frequency, the share of policies with at least one claim, is 2.92%, and the average claim severity (amount paid per claim) is $21,035.

Across 5 years (2018–2022), premiums in ZIP 77505 have risen by 8.0%, ranging from $3,035 to $3,289 with a five-year average of $3,132, an annualized rate of +1.9% per year.

FEMA NRI places Harris County in the upper risk band at 99.9 (Very High): national 100th percentile, #1/245 inside Texas, and 98% above the 50.5 state mean. Top hazard on the map is Hurricane. Social Vulnerability Index 67.9 · Community Resilience 17.9. NRI does not price policies; it situates the county.

How to read these numbers

The figures on this page come from the U.S. Treasury Federal Insurance Office, which collects homeowners insurance premium and claims data directly from the largest property insurers in the country. Because the data is aggregated at the ZIP-code level and averaged across many policies, it describes the typical cost in an area rather than a quote for any single home. Two houses on the same street can pay very different premiums depending on their age, construction type, roof condition, prior claims, and the specific coverage limits and deductibles the homeowner selects. The loss ratio shows how much of every premium dollar insurers paid back out as claims; a ratio above one means carriers lost money locally, which often precedes rate increases or carrier exits. Rising nonrenewal and claim frequency reveal how stressed the local market has become. Use these figures to gauge the direction and scale of costs in your area, then request quotes from several licensed carriers before buying or renewing a policy. FIO data aggregates voluntary reporting from the 40 largest homeowners insurers, covering roughly 80% of the U.S. market, so figures represent market averages rather than individual policy quotes; your own premium will vary with dwelling value, deductible, coverage limits, construction type, and insurer-specific underwriting.
